Health Awareness Services offers urine pregnancy testing. It must be
12 days since your last unprotected sex for a pregnancy test to be
accurate. If indicated, we can provide blood pregnancy testing as well.
Pregnancy testing is done on site and if urine pregnancy testing is
done, the results are given the same day.
- If a pregnancy test is negative and you are not seeking
pregnancy, birth control options are reviewed, discussed and
offered.
- If a pregnancy test is positive and you are
uncertain about what you want to do, we will provide you with
information about all
options available to you. Health Awareness does not provide.
pre-natal care or abortion services (referrals are made).
Information and referral related to
pre-natal care, adoption and abortion services are provided.
- If you are seeking pregnancy and experience problems getting
pregnant, we will make a referral to an OB/GYN for you.
- If you have had unprotected sex within 5 days (120 hours) and
wish to prevent a pregnancy emergency contraception is an option you
may want to consider.
